The cancer pain remedies explained Cancer pain is a complex and often distressing experience for patients, impacting their quality of life significantly. Managing this pain requires a comprehensive understanding of the different remedies available, tailored to each individual’s condition, type of cancer, and pain intensity. The primary goal is to relieve suffering while maintaining the patient’s ability to function and enjoy life as much as possible.
One of the most common approaches to cancer pain management is the use of medications. Analgesics, or pain relievers, form the cornerstone of treatment. Non-opioid analgesics such as acetaminophen and non-steroidal anti-inflammatory drugs (NSAIDs) are typically used for mild to moderate pain. They work by reducing inflammation or altering pain perception. For more severe pain, opioids like morphine, oxycodone, or fentanyl are prescribed. These medications are highly effective but require careful monitoring to manage side effects such as drowsiness, constipation, or risk of dependence. Recent advances include the development of modified-release formulations and patch systems to provide continuous pain control.
Adjuvant therapies often complement medication regimens to enhance pain relief or address specific pain types. For example, antidepressants and anticonvulsants are used primarily for nerve pain or neuropathic pain, which is common in cancer patients experiencing nerve compression or damage from treatments. Corticosteroids can reduce inflammation and swelling that contribute to pain, especially in cases involving tumors pressing on nerves or other structures. Additionally, bisphosphonates and denosumab are used to manage bone pain caused by metastases, helping to strengthen bones and reduce discomfort.
Beyond pharmacological measures, physical therapies play a vital role in cancer pain management. Techniques such as massage, acupuncture, and physical therapy can alleviate muscle tension, improve circulation, and reduce pain perception. These modalities are particularly beneficial in cases where medication alone is insufficient or causes intolerable side effects. Complementary therapies like relaxation techniques, guided imagery, and biofeedback can help patients manage pain by reducing anxiety and emotional distress that often exacerbate physical discomfort.
In recent years, interventional procedures have gained importance, particularly for localized or severe pain not responding well to medication. These include nerve blocks, epidural infusions, and radiotherapy. Nerve blocks involve injecting anesthetic agents directly near nerves or nerve plexuses to block pain signals. Epidural infusions deliver continuous doses of pain medication directly into the spinal fluid, providing targeted relief. Radiotherapy can shrink tumors causing pain or reduce nerve compression, offering a more definitive solution in certain cases.
Emerging treatments like cannabis-based medicines and novel drug delivery systems are also being studied for their potential in pain management. These options may provide additional relief with fewer side effects, but they require careful consideration and consultation with healthcare providers.
Ultimately, effective cancer pain management is a multidisciplinary effort, involving oncologists, pain specialists, physical therapists, and mental health professionals. Communication between patients and healthcare teams is crucial to tailor treatments that maximize relief, minimize side effects, and improve overall well-being.
